    Inside Mirvish Productions' & Juliet: Matt Raffy on Broadway, Identity & Big Dreams

    On this episode of Table 6ix, hosts Dana Duncanson and Tiana Atapattu Jayatunga sit down with Matt Raffy, performer in & Juliet at Toronto's Royal Alexandra Theatre, to explore the discipline, resilience, and passion behind a career in theatre. Created by Canadian writer David West Read (Schitt's Creek) and featuring the chart-topping music of Max Martin, & Juliet reimagines Shakespeare's iconic heroine by asking one powerful question: What if Juliet chose herself? Matt shares what it's like being part of a production that's redefining modern musical theatre through pop music, inclusive storytelling, and characters that resonate with today's audiences. From representing Canadian talent on major stages to navigating auditions, rejection, and the realities behind the spotlight, this conversation offers an honest look at what it means to pursue creative dreams at the highest level.     Play, Power & Public Art: Reimagining Toronto with Olivia Ansell of Luminato Festival

    Toronto’s cultural identity is constantly evolving — and Luminato Festival is one of the biggest forces shaping how we experience the city. On this episode of Table 6ix, we sit down to explore how public art, storytelling, and community-driven experiences help build civic pride, spark creativity, and make culture more accessible for everyone. From the meaning behind this year’s festival theme of “play” to the return of iconic installations like the Red Ball Project, the conversation dives into why public art matters, how festivals can bring people together during uncertain times, and the responsibility cultural institutions have in creating more inclusive narratives across Toronto. We unpack the power of nostalgia, the role of equity in storytelling, and what 20 years of public art reveals about the evolution of Toronto itself — while reflecting on how creativity, imagination, and “play” show up in everyday life.     Unfiltered & Unstoppable: BEAR Steak’s Rise to Success with Aki Erenberg and Ricky Barrientos

    In this inspiring episode of Table 6ix, hosts Tiana Atapattu Jayatunga and Dana Duncanson sit down with Aki Erenberg and Ricky Barrientos, the founders behind one of Toronto’s most talked-about food success stories: BEAR Steak Sandwiches. From a mother’s backyard during the Covid-19 lockdowns to becoming a Little Italy staple with a recently opened second location at The Well, Aki and Ricky share the grit, heart, and hustle behind their rise.This conversation dives into the power of community, the unseen intensity of building a food business from scratch and how documenting their journey through their YouTube docuseries The Backyard Boys is shaping the next chapter of their growth.
